I seem to be young blood here, as I only got my game first for PC only in May 2010. But I tell you, the first moment I launched it, it felt... Well, different.

I played SA, and VC before, in that order, and having read many articles and guides about this game, I expected it to be somewhere near.... But it has overcome all my expectations. Talking from today's point of view, the game is 'quite primitive', as my dad also says, but I guess that its simplicity, combined with the game world that was unlike the sunny Vice City and San Andreas, instead being a gloomy industrial city, filled with all those sounds both VC and SA lacked, is what made me hook up.

I used to spend hours a day wandering around Portland just enjoying the scenery. It may sound strange... But I felt that Liberty City was my home. And I still feel that now.

In short, it was magnificent. And even now, I feel somewhere the same, although a bit different already.
